A. 解决网页上pdf打开乱码问题的方法如何处理网页上PDF乱码及常见解决方案
然而,许多用户在打开PDF文件时可能会遇到乱码问题、给浏览和阅读带来了困扰、越来越多的资料以PDF格式在网页上呈现、随着网络技术的发展。并提供一些常见的解决方案,本文将介绍如何解决网页上PDF打开乱码的问题。
一、了解PDF格式的特点与编码方式
PDF(PortableDocumentFormat)它具有独立于应用软件,硬件和操作系统的特点,是由Adobe公司开发的一种跨平台的电子文档格式。表格等内容,其中文字通常使用Unicode编码或者其他字体编码方式进行存储,图片,PDF文件可以包含文本、超链接。
二、检查PDF文件是否完整
如果文件本身不完整或损坏,就有可能导致乱码问题,在打开PDF文件时。可以通过重新下载或从其他来源获取相同的PDF文件来解决此问题。
三、更新或更换PDF阅读器软件
而不同的PDF阅读器对编码的支持程度不同,所以在打开PDF文件时会出现乱码,有些PDF文件可能使用了特定的编码方式。以找到最适合您的版本,建议尝试更新或更换不同版本的PDF阅读器软件。
四、修改浏览器设置
有时,浏览器本身的设置可能会导致PDF打开乱码。例如将字符编码设置为自动识别或者手动选择UTF,可以尝试在浏览器中修改相关设置-8编码。
五、使用在线PDF转换工具
并且尝试了以上方法仍无法解决、如果您打开的PDF文件一直存在乱码问题,可以尝试使用在线PDF转换工具。如Word或HTML,这些工具可以将PDF文件转换为其他格式,然后再尝试打开。
六、检查PDF文件的字体嵌入情况
有时,PDF文件的字体嵌入不完整或出现问题也会导致乱码。并尝试重新嵌入字体或更换其他字体进行解决、可以通过PDF编辑软件检查字体嵌入情况。
七、清除浏览器缓存和Cookie
导致乱码问题,浏览器缓存和Cookie中的临时数据可能会对PDF打开产生干扰。并重新打开PDF文件,尝试清除浏览器缓存和Cookie。
八、检查操作系统的语言设置
操作系统的语言设置也可能对PDF打开产生影响。就有可能导致乱码、如果您的操作系统语言设置与PDF文件中的编码方式不匹配。可以尝试调整操作系统的语言设置来解决此问题。
九、使用专业的PDF修复工具
可以考虑使用专业的PDF修复工具,如果您经常遇到PDF打开乱码的问题。从而恢复正常的阅读效果,这些工具能够检测并修复PDF文件中的编码问题。
十、检查网络连接状况
有时,PDF打开乱码问题可能是由于网络连接不稳定或者网络传输出现错误导致的。可以尝试重新连接网络或者等待网络恢复正常后再次打开PDF文件。
十一、尝试打开其他PDF文件
那么可能是该PDF文件本身存在问题、如果您只在特定的PDF文件中遇到乱码问题,而其他PDF文件则正常打开。可以尝试打开其他PDF文件来确定问题是否出在文件本身。
十二、联系PDF文件提供方
可以尝试联系PDF文件提供方寻求帮助、如果您无法解决PDF打开乱码问题。他们可能会提供更准确的解决方案或者重新提供一个无乱码问题的PDF文件。
十三、备份并重新下载PDF文件
最后的一种解决方案是备份并重新下载PDF文件,如果您在尝试了以上方法后仍无法解决问题。重新下载一个干净的PDF文件可能解决问题,原始的PDF文件可能已经损坏或者存在问题、有时。
十四、定期更新软件和插件
建议定期更新您使用的PDF阅读器、浏览器以及相关插件、为了避免乱码问题的发生。并提供更好的兼容性和性能、新版软件通常会修复一些已知的乱码问题。
十五、包括检查PDF文件的完整性,更新PDF阅读器软件、使用在线PDF转换工具等,本文介绍了解决网页上PDF打开乱码问题的多种方法,修改浏览器设置。提升阅读体验、解决PDF打开乱码问题,希望读者能够根据实际情况选择合适的解决方案。
越来越多的文档以PDF格式在网页上进行展示,随着信息技术的不断发展。给阅读和使用带来了一定的困扰、然而,有时候我们会遇到网页上打开PDF时出现乱码的情况。帮助读者解决这一问题,本文将介绍一些常见的解决方法。
一、排查操作系统和浏览器问题
1.检查操作系统是否正常安装了字体库
首先需要确认操作系统是否正常安装了所需的字体库,在开始处理网页PDF乱码问题之前。有时候字体库缺失或损坏可能导致PDF文件在浏览器中显示乱码。
2.确认浏览器是否支持PDF预览功能
这可能导致乱码问题,某些浏览器可能无法正确预览PDF文件。并及时更新浏览器版本,请确认您使用的浏览器是否支持PDF预览功能。
二、调整浏览器设置
3.清除浏览器缓存和Cookie
导致乱码问题,浏览器缓存和Cookie中的数据可能会与PDF文件的加载和显示相关。然后重新打开PDF文件查看是否正常显示,尝试清除浏览器缓存和Cookie。
4.禁用浏览器的PDF预览插件
导致PDF文件显示乱码,某些PDF预览插件可能与其他浏览器插件冲突。然后重新打开PDF文件查看效果,可以尝试禁用浏览器的PDF预览插件。
三、使用PDF阅读器插件
5.安装可信赖的PDF阅读器插件
可以尝试安装一款可信赖的PDF阅读器插件,为避免浏览器内置的PDF阅读器出现兼容性问题。可以更好地解决乱码问题,这些插件通常具有更强大的功能和更好的兼容性。
6.调整PDF阅读器插件的设置
可能需要根据实际需求调整其相关设置,在安装了PDF阅读器插件之后。以解决乱码问题、可以尝试调整字体渲染方式,字体替换策略等。
四、更新字体库
7.更新系统字体库
有时候操作系统的字体库版本过旧可能导致PDF文件显示乱码。以获得更好的兼容性和显示效果,可以尝试更新操作系统的字体库。
8.安装缺失的字体
这可能导致乱码问题、某些PDF文件可能使用了特定的字体,而您的系统中并未安装该字体。从而解决显示乱码的问题、可以尝试安装缺失的字体。
五、其他解决方法
9.尝试使用其他浏览器打开PDF文件
可以尝试使用其他浏览器打开同样的PDF文件,如果您在某个浏览器中遇到了PDF乱码问题。切换浏览器可能有助于解决问题,有时候不同浏览器的兼容性存在差异。
10.将PDF文件下载后再打开
直接在网页上打开PDF文件可能会导致乱码问题,在某些情况下。然后使用PDF阅读器软件打开,可以尝试将PDF文件下载到本地,观察是否还存在乱码问题。
11.检查PDF文件本身是否损坏
这会导致乱码问题,有时候PDF文件本身就存在问题,可能损坏或者格式错误。以确定问题是否出在PDF文件本身、可以尝试使用其他PDF阅读器打开同一文件。
12.联系PDF文件的提供方
可以尝试联系文件的提供方、如果您从网上下载的PDF文件一直无法正确显示。他们可能能提供更多的帮助或者替代的文件格式供您使用。
六、
更新字体库等方法,调整浏览器设置,使用PDF阅读器插件,我们可以有效解决这一问题,但是通过排查操作系统和浏览器问题、在网页上打开PDF文件时出现乱码问题是一个常见的困扰。希望本文介绍的方法能对读者解决网页PDF乱码问题提供帮助。
B. 《码书:编码与解码的战争》pdf下载在线阅读全文,求百度网盘云资源
《码书:编码与解码的战争》网络网盘pdf最新全集下载:
链接:https://pan..com/s/18-u1hc11ak0iaLUNQ5JDRA
C. 显示base64编码的pdf
将base64格式的pdf在新标签页打开:
var objstr = '';
objstr += ('<object width="100%" height="100%" data="data:application/pdf;base64,');
objstr += (base64string);
objstr += ('" type="application/pdf">');
objstr += ('<embed src="data:application/pdf;base64,');
objstr += (base64string);
objstr += ('" type="application/pdf" />');
objstr += ('</object>');
var win = window.open("#", "_blank");
var title = "标题";
win.document.write('<html><title>'+ title +'</title><body style="margin: 0px;">');
win.document.write(objstr);
win.document.write('</body></html>');
layer = jQuery(win.document);
D. 非标准编码pdf如何转换
可以用ocr(光学辨识)软件来转换,比如abbyyfinereader、汉王ocr、wondersharepro来转换